“The Arkansas Grand Prix is a year-long series of road and cross-country races administered by the Arkansas chapter of the Road Runners Club of America (RRCA). To enter the Arkansas Grand Prix, a runner must first belong to one of the Arkansas RRCA Running Clubs, located throughout the state. The clubs also compete against one another in the Team Competition.
Runners and clubs accumulate points based on finishing order in each race. Awards are given to top runners and teams at an annual awards ceremony in February following the conclusion of the Grand Prix Series. The Watermelon 5K*Hope Watermelon 5K – August 13, 2022

The Watermelon 5K was established in 1978 though in the first few years the race distance was 4 miles. The race has been part of the Arkansas RRCA Grand Prix Series since 1994.

 

ARK 5K41st Annual ARK 5K Classic – September 3, 2022

41 years of the Arkansas 5K. The race will take place in Northshore Industrial Park and will consist of a fairly flat course.

Great 5K Pumpkin Run – September 24, 2022

Run the 5K that begins at the Historic Lonoke Train Depot, winding its way by the Lonoke City Park and through beautiful small-town neighborhoods. Known for its flat as a pancake course, the chipped 5K Pumpkin Run is made for setting a personal record.

*Arkansas 20KArkansas 20k – October 29, 2022

The 2022 Arkansas 20K will start and end at the River Center in Benton. All turns are marked with large signs with arrows. The race will be chip timed. The course will remain open until 11:00 am.
